About the role

Total Spectrum (www.totalspectrumcare.com) is seeking Managing Behavior Analysts to oversee the delivery of behavior treatment services with support from Managing Technicians, Assistant Behavior Analysts, and other Behavior Analysts. The role involves providing clinically excellent services to clients and their families, and promoting the professional development of program managers and technicians.

Responsibilities

  • Provide clinical direction to program managers and technicians for assigned clients
  • Deliver protocol modification, assessment, and family treatment guidance for assigned clients
  • Ensure data is collected and recorded with fidelity and reliability
  • Complete mandatory trainings and attend required meetings
  • Document services delivered accurately and timely according to company policies
  • Partner with Clinical Director regarding staffing and scheduling for clients
  • Report clinical and scheduling concerns promptly
  • Adhere to all company compliance policies, written or unwritten
  • Complete other tasks as assigned by supervisor

Requirements

  • Masters Degree
  • Minimum of 3 years of experience as a Board Certified Behavior Analyst working with children with autism
  • Licenses as required by local statutes to deliver ABAS
  • Supervision fluency, including performance monitoring of clinical team and consistent utilization of a system to monitor client progress during field supervision
  • Fluency/independence in navigating challenging situations with families, funding sources, or staff
  • Experience with multiple funding sources and report templates
  • Experience with Functional Behavior Assessments (FBAs)
  • Understanding of pre-requisite skills across domains, goal progression, and addressing programming related issues
  • Fluency in reviewing client's authorized hours and supporting the maximization of hours for a caseload
  • Independence in creating fade out plans that are derived from caregiver input, client and caregiver progress on goals, and assessment results
